My build looks like this.

353.3ci
Forged Eagle crank
Forged Scat rods
Forged -5cc CP Pistons, rings gapped for nitrous
LS1 lid conversion
58mm TB
40# injectors
LTCC Coil Conversion
LS2 Coils
LE Fully Ported Intake
LE 21* Trickflow Heads 2.055in, 1.60ex valves 215cc Intake runners
LE Cam 237/245 .603/.611 110LSA
LS7 Lifters
1.6 Ultra Pro Mags
1.75" Longtubes
3600-4000 Performabuilt 10.5" billet stall (shipping it back for a restall, currently undecided on how big I want to go)
Performabuilt Level 2 4L60e
3.73 gears
10 bolt for a little while until i can afford a 12 bolt
A/C Delete and EWP
Drag Radials (currently a good set of 555R's, going to MT's after the nittos are used up)
BMR Lower control arms
150-200 shot of nitrous from NOS wet kit and progressive controller.

Went from LE2's and LE HR cam ran 11.35 @ 122 to AI 212 TFS and AI HR cam ran 11.10 @ 124. It lost bottom end but gained power up top. Everything else in the car stayed the same, other than the tune. LE setup done on dyno by Ed Wright, AI setup done on a dyno Moehorsepower. Different weather and dyno's so numbers really arent compairable but total HP and TQ was within 25 between setups.
